Transaction 764d975ed3fe4f85246ecd4d27981e33da4c24e208891fda2773360a8413e69a
1 Input
1 Output
-
764d975ed3fe4f85246ecd4d27981e33da4c24e208891fda2773360a8413e69a:0
- value
- 1670214
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 53dfa5a46ce879c65a72ced898c14195a5efdbe6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18eV1C4WYqvaDvNCjLfGtuZjVEWYhzmmkF